CVE-2026-26070: EVerest: OCPP 2.0.1 EV SoC Update Race Causes Charge Point Crash
EVerest is an EV charging software stack. Versions prior to 2026.02.0 have a data race leading to std::map<std::optional> concurrent access (container/optional corruption possible). The trigger is an EV SoC update with powermeter periodic update and unplugging/SessionFinished state. Version 2026.2.0 contains a patch.
